def start_game(self): ''' 游戏开始 ''' pygame.display.init() MainGame.screen=pygame.display.set_mode((SCREEN_WEGTH,SCREEN_HIGHT)) pygame.display.set_caption('坦克大战') MainGame.my_tank = MyTank(350,300) self.create_enemy_tank() while True: # MainGame.screen.fill(BG_COLOR) text = self.get_text_surface(f'{MainGame.enemy_num}个敌方坦克') MainGame.screen.blit(text, (10, 10)) self.event() MainGame.my_tank.display_tank() self.display_enermy_tank() pygame.display.update()
老师,为什么我不给窗口设置填充色,移动我方坦克方向,我方坦克会叠加显示啊
老师下面那个提问为什么做法相同,我的却报错
#include<iostream> #include<limits> #include<math.h> using namespace std; int main() { unsigned long long a=std::numeric_limits<unsigneAd long long >::max(); cout <<a<<endl; cout <<log10(a)<<endl; // unsigned long long a= 1; // cout<<a<<endl; // while(1) // { // } return 0; }
1;请问以下代码错那里了
2;变量为什莫是a b为什莫不行
3;求数值的长为什莫用log,从以上代码中如何看出log(a)等于e?
重置的时候不能把resest写在from标签中吗?跟老师讲的方法区别是什么呢?
#include <iostream> using namespace std; int main() { cout << "Hello World!" << endl; return 0; }
1;为什么每段代码都要隔一行才能开始下一句的编译。
2;cout后跟的为什么是<<"hello world"<<endl;而不是<<"hello world">>endl;这样
3;return后面为什么要跟个0的数字字符作为结尾.
没有解决
这么一贴出来我看出来了是第一个分号错了,中文分号。
./bendi.sh:行10: 寻找匹配的 `"' 是遇到了未预期的文件结束符 ./bendi.sh:行11: 语法错误: 未预期的文件结尾 [root@node1 ch4]# vim bendi.sh [root@node1 ch4]# cat bendi.sh #!/bin/bash a=88 echo “a = $a" myfuna(){ myvar=66 echo "inner myfuna myvar=$myvar" } echo "before myfuna myvar=$myvar" myfuna echo "after myfuna myvar=$myvar"
Qt Certor的安装包麻烦老师提供下
老师,这两个答案都是5050,不是说从什么数字开始计算的话,变量的值也是这个数字吗,为什么不是num=1,而是num=1呢
2.我这个不知道为什么运行不了
num=sum_all=num<=: sum_all=sum_all+num num=+(sum_all)
这个语句最后要背下来 还是用到了找得到这一条就行
老师,我的控制台没有输出这些信息
老师,这个我好想之前下过tomcat,这个还需要重新下吗
老师,这里为什么显示出错呢,也没有空了字符串呀
我这里为啥没有自动增长选项
非常抱歉给您带来不好的体验!为了更深入的了解您的学习情况以及遇到的问题,您可以直接拨打投诉热线:
我们将在第一时间处理好您的问题!
关于
课程分类
百战程序员微信公众号
百战程序员微信小程序
©2014-2025百战汇智(北京)科技有限公司 All Rights Reserved 北京亦庄经济开发区科创十四街 赛蒂国际工业园网站维护:百战汇智(北京)科技有限公司 京公网安备 11011402011233号 京ICP备18060230号-3 营业执照 经营许可证:京B2-20212637